Will your lights stay on when the neighborhood goes dark?

Frequent or prolonged outages, storm‑related worries, or reliance on medical equipment or home offices mean you need a backup generator. Rural areas with slow repairs, aging grids, or severe weather also benefit from standby power that keeps lights on when others go dark.

  • Frequent or prolonged outages that jeopardize food storage, comfort, or remote work.
  • Critical equipment (medical devices, sump/well pumps, security systems) that can’t go down.
  • All‑electric HVAC or heat pumps that need stable power for safety and comfort.
  • EV charging, new additions, or higher electrical demand and you want true whole‑home coverage.
  • Portable‑generator fatigue—fuel trips, cords, fumes—and a preference for a safe, automatic solution.
  • Concern about surge events that can damage sensitive electronics during power restoration.

  • Right‑Sizing & Load Calculations
    We start with a detailed load study—service size, feeder/panel capacity, and your lifestyle priorities. You’ll get a clear kW recommendation (whole‑home or essential‑circuits coverage) with optional smart load‑shedding for large draws (ovens, pool heaters, EVSE). Right‑sizing avoids nuisance trips and unnecessary fuel use.
  • Automatic Transfer Switches (ATS)
    We install listed, service‑entrance‑rated ATS equipment that senses outages and transfers selected circuits—or your entire home—to generator power, then safely returns to utility when it’s back. Enclosures, conductor sizing, overcurrent protection, and labeling are handled to code, with a simple one‑line diagram in your closeout packet.
  • Placement, Sound & Aesthetics
    Location matters for safety and comfort. We select a pad site with proper clearances, ventilation, and service access, route conduit with tidy, straight runs, and orient exhaust thoughtfully. Modern residential units are engineered for quiet operation; placement and shielding strategies help keep sound unobtrusive and neighbor‑friendly.
  • Fuel & Utility Coordination
    We coordinate with licensed gas contractors/utility providers for natural gas or propane supply, meter/regulator sizing, and pressure confirmation. All gas piping and leak checks are performed by appropriately licensed parties. You get one coordinated schedule, one point of contact.
  • Grounding, Bonding & Surge Protection
    Proper grounding/bonding protects people and equipment. We can add whole‑home surge protection at the service and sensitive sub‑panels to safeguard electronics during storms and switching events.
  • Commissioning, Monitoring & Maintenance
    We perform start‑up, simulate an outage, verify transfer/voltage stability under load, program exercise schedules, and—where supported—enable app‑based remote monitoring for status and alerts. You’ll receive a guided walkthrough, quick‑reference cards, and a maintenance calendar.

No surprises, just clear timelines.

  1. Free Electrical Consultation – Discuss essential loads, priorities, and site conditions; answer questions and outline next steps.
  2. On‑Site Evaluation & Custom Plan – Load study, panel/service review, placement options, fuel source discussion; receive a clear, itemized proposal and timeline.
  3. Permitting & Coordination – We submit electrical permits, coordinate inspection windows, and schedule licensed gas partners/utility for meter/regulator needs.
  4. Pad & Equipment Set – Prepare pad, set generator, install ATS and disconnects, route conductors with clean penetrations and weatherproofing.
  5. Electrical Integration – Land conductors, torque/verify terminations, label circuits, and set exercise schedules; optional surge protection installed.
  6. Commissioning & Walkthrough – Start‑up, simulate an outage, verify full function; set up monitoring (where supported) and deliver owner training.
  7. Closeout & Support – Provide as‑builts/manuals, inspection sign‑offs, and maintenance plan options; priority response available after major events.
